Hello guys, I've a 94 7AFE manual transmission and I need the ECU wiring diagram of my car or just to know if 7AFE and 4AFE pins are the same.
If none available I just need to know which is the ECU pin for the O2 sensor SIGNAL.

You can check the oxygen/Lambda sensor voltage at the DLC1 (data link box)
in the engine bay (Voltage between pin TE1 and E1/Earth),

The 7AFE (1.8ST) has 2 oxy sensors, main one is hooked
up to the Data link connector on the left rear of engine bay,the same link runs of to the ECU pin 6, pin 5 being
the second sub oxy sensor, both wires are coloured white,
